No tank tests and no other tests, we did not even have the D40 in the water until after the boat show when she was launched last year, so it was pure luck..
The handling is very good with no issues, they turn without sliding and without losing speed. They have no pitching and lifts the bow just a minimum to get on plane. So the performance figures are a combination of the hull shape and the low weight plus of course the modern diesel engines from VolvoPenta. We will soon test a D40 with the latest Mercruisers as well.
We also have forward sloping windows on fishing boats and smaller multi-purpose boats like the Targa line from Finland. But those are higher and slower than ours. In our archipelago with many thousand islands, it is essential to have a good and glare-free view, especially when it is dark.
